What You'll Actually Do in This Bloody Sandbox

Once you’re in, the gameplay loop is refreshingly unfiltered. You spawn into a space filled with interactive objects — cars you can drive into walls, barrels you can roll into crowds, and buildings you can demolish piece by piece. And then there are the ragdoll characters: pixelated humans you can shoot, stab, blow up, or run over. The physics engine makes every collision satisfyingly unpredictable. You might toss a grenade into a group and watch their limbs fly in opposite directions, or drive a truck through a wooden structure and see it collapse in a shower of blocks.

The developers didn’t stop at just the chaos. They built a surprisingly deep arsenal. You get access to a wide variety of weapons — from pistols and shotguns to rocket launchers and melee tools. But what really sets this apart is the audio design. The sound effects are brutally realistic. Every gunshot, every explosion, every squish of a pixelated body landing on concrete is crisp and weighty. For anyone who appreciates good weapon audio, this is pure ASMR. You’ll find yourself reloading just to hear the click of the magazine, or firing a shotgun into a crowd just to feel the boom in your headphones.

  • Build your own death arena in creative mode and invite friends to test your traps.
  • Drive vehicles like cars and trucks into structures to see the physics engine break.
  • Choose from a massive arsenal including shotguns, rocket launchers, and melee weapons.
  • Experience realistic audio with every gunshot and explosion feeling heavy and immersive.
  • Play on pre-made maps designed for instant action, or create your own from scratch.

Why This Sandbox Keeps You Coming Back

The beauty of GoreBox (Old) is that it never tells you what to do. You can spend an hour just driving cars into walls, watching the pixelated debris fly. Or you can build a complex trap with barrels, explosives, and a vehicle, then lure characters into your kill zone. The creative mode is where the game truly shines — you can design custom maps with unique gameplay dynamics, then share them with other players. Want a map that’s just a giant pit with spikes at the bottom? Build it. Want a maze filled with tripwires and explosives? Go ahead. The only rule is that there are no rules.

Even if you’re not the creative type, the pre-made maps offer plenty of variety. Some are open fields for vehicular mayhem, others are tight corridors for close-quarters gunfights. You can play solo or with friends, and the multiplayer aspect adds a whole new layer of fun — watching your buddy accidentally blow themselves up with a misplaced grenade is always a highlight. The game doesn’t take itself seriously, and that’s exactly why it works. It’s a pressure-free space to unwind, experiment, and laugh at the absurdity of it all.
